The scientific name of arrowroot is Maranta arundinacea. This tropical plant is cultivated for its starchy rhizomes, which are used as a food thickener and in various culinary applications. Arrowroot is known for its easy digestibility and is often used in gluten-free recipes.

What is the scientific name of the Late Coral Root Orchid?

Corallorhiza odontorhiza is the scientific, Latin or binomial name of the Late Coral Root.Specifically, a scientific name includes at least two names. The first part is the genus of the coral root orchids, Corallorhiza. The second part is the species of toothed root orchids within that genus, odontorhiza. This scientific name also may be found linked with the Autumn Coral Root and the Small Coral Root, which are other common names for the very same plant.
